HP
HP Inc. is a technology company that produces personal computers, printers, and related supplies. Following its 2015 split from Hewlett Packard Enterprise, HP focused on personal systems and printing. The company has been integrating AI into its products including intelligent printing, PC performance optimization, and sustainability features.
Motorola
Motorola, Inc. was an American multinational telecommunications company based in Schaumburg, Illinois, founded in 1928. The company was a pioneer in cellular telephones and produced a wide range of radio-related communication equipment, including two-way radios, mobile phones, cellular infrastructure, pagers, and semiconductors. It also designed and sold wireless network equipment for business and government customers, as well as home and broadcast network products like set-top boxes. After significant financial losses, Motorola was split into two independent public companies in 2011: Motorola Solutions, its legal successor which took on the business and government units, and Motorola Mobility, which was spun off with the consumer handset division. Motorola Mobility is now a subsidiary of Lenovo and continues to develop mobile devices, including recent innovations in foldable smartphones and wearable AI concepts.
